Arturia has announced the availability of Version 1.1 of Oberheim SEM V, the latest update to its recently released (Standalone, VST 2.4 & 3 -- 32- and 64-bit, RTAS and AU -- 32- and 64-bit) software emulation of the legendary Oberheim Synthesizer Expander Module. Here's what Arturia has to say...
Arturia's Oberheim SEM V faithfully reproduces the analogue warmth and ingenious interface of the Synthesizer Expander Module® (or SEM for short) -- one of the most iconic instruments of the analogue era, and Oberheim's first official analogue monosynth to boot. (Upon its introduction in 1974, the SEM was originally conceived as a way of beefing up weaker-sounding compatible analogue synths, or performing simplistic sequenced parts, before becoming a sought-after sound in its own right.)
While accurately recreating the two-oscillator tone, waveshapes (sawtooth, variable-width pulsewave with PWM, sine wave LFO), multimode 12dB/octave filter (with low-pass, high-pass, band-pass, and notch), and other characteristics (two ADS envelope generators, etc) of its notable namesake analogue ancestor, Oberheim SEM V brings many more truly 21st Century features and benefits to the music technology table -- including polyphony (plus eight-voice multitimbrality); MIDI control; arpeggiation; portamento; sub-oscillator; second LFO; white noise; onboard effects (overdrive, chorus, and delay); and a new Modulation Matrix module -- that considerably widens its sonic palette and appeal.
Oberheim SEM V not only excels at ultra-fat basses and textured leads, but also delivers the stunning sequences and ethereal pads present on Oberheim's original Eight Voice monstrous model -- made up of eight SEMs paired with the Polyphonic Synthesizer Programmer (for rudimentary recalling of patches), a simple analogue mixer, and a 49-note keyboard -- thanks to its intuitive 8-Voice Programmer -- now with new 'Reassign' and 'Forward Retrig' modes, mirroring Oberheim's original multi-SEM synths' voice assignment (using non-gated boards first) and triggering (restarting from the first board when releasing all gates) -- and advanced Keyboard Follow modules.
Version 1.1 comes preloaded with more than 100 new factory presets by world-class sound designers (Ian Boddy; Richard Courtel; Kevin Lamb; Drew Newman; and Erik Norlander), plus powerful new features aplenty: adjustable polyphony (to limit the polyphony of the plug-in -- just like Oberheim's original multi-SEM synths); faster preset management; active sustain pedal (on all systems); and improved performance on all DAWs (notably Apple Logic and Avid Pro Tools).

Pricing and Availability:
Oberheim SEM V is available to purchase from Arturia's Online shop) as Mac-compatible (OS X 10.5 or higher -- Intel only) and PC-compatible (Windows XP, Vista, and 7 -- 32- and 64-bit) boxed software for €229.00 EURO/$249.00 USD or as a software download for €220.00 EURO/$239.00 USD. (The Version 1.1 upgrade is free for all registered users.) More information:
